Can I camp in Vt right now?

Can I camp in Vt right now?

If you’re feeling spontaneous, you can camp in a campground without reservations, space permitting. Most parks, even in summer, will have at least a few sites available, especially mid-week. Vermont State Parks do not hold a specific number of sites open for “drive-in” campers.

Do Vermont state parks have RV hookups?

There are no hookups in Vermont State Parks campgrounds, but there are dump stations and water spigots. Vermont is also home to private campgrounds that offer amenities and amazing locations.

Are dogs allowed at Vt state parks?

Pets in Day Use Areas Pets are not permitted on beaches or in picnic areas* Pets are permitted in all campgrounds and trails unless otherwise designated. Pets must be on a leash less than 10′ or safely confined at all times. Your pet is expected to have current rabies vaccination.

Are there bears in Farragut State Park?

A diverse biological community exists in this scenic forest setting of lodgepole pine, ponderosa pine, white pine, Douglas fir, poplar, western larch and grand fir. The forests are home to whitetail deer, squirrels, black bears, coyotes and bobcats.

What is a lean-to camping?

A lean-to is a three-sided log structure that has an overhanging roof. Lean-tos make perfect shelters for camping, and many are found along Adirondack trails.
